March 30-31: working visit to the Republic of Senegal

5 April 2022

Chairman of the Halal Standards Committee Abbyas Hazrat Shlyaposhnikov, as part of the delegation of the Republic of Tatarstan, headed by the President of the Republic of Tatarstan Rustam Minnikhanov, took part in the business forum “Tatarstan – Senegal” in Dakar.

The main purpose of the official visit of the Tatarstan delegation was expressed by its leader R. Minnikhanov:

“It is very important for us to find good reliable partners, industry and agriculture are developed in our region, we are ready to work in these areas. In turn, favorable conditions for investors have been created in Senegal and this is a good hub to move on to other West African countries.”

As part of the program of the forum, Abbyas Hazrat Shlyaposhnikov made a presentation at the round table and held a number of working meetings with representatives of Senegal’s business circles.

During the meeting with the Director General of the Senegalese Association for Standardization (Association S?n?galaise de Normalization (ASN) El-Hadj Abdurakhman Ndion, interaction issues were discussed, and a memorandum of understanding and cooperation was concluded between the Senegalese Association for Standardization and the Halal Standard Committee of the MSB RT The parties agreed on cooperation and exchange of experience in the field of Halal standardization and certification, as well as on joint work to expand opportunities in bilateral trade in Halal products between the Republic of Senegal and Tatarstan.

In his speech, at the round table of the business forum “Tatarstan – Senegal”, Abbyas Khazrat outlined the main directions and tasks for the development of the Halal industry in the Republic of Tatarstan. The report noted the significant work and support carried out by the President and the Government of the Republic of Tatarstan in the field of Halal – the expansion of production and export of Halal products, the introduction of the HALAL LIFE STYLE project at the state level, the integration of Halal principles into various sectors of the economy of Tatarstan: agriculture, food industry, tourism , medicine, IT-technologies.

The Chairman of the Committee also noted that the Ministry of Industry and Trade and the Ministry of Agriculture and Food of the Republic of Tajikistan provide all possible support to the republican producers in Halal products.

“The first steps have already been taken in this direction – food products are being supplied from Tatarstan to the countries of the Arab world. A number of our manufacturing enterprises are now ready to supply their products to the OIC countries,” he added.

At the end of his speech, Hazrat Abbyas invited colleagues from the Republic of Senegal to the exhibition of the halal industry “Russia Halal Expo”, which will be held on May 19-21 at the site of the international economic summit “Russia – Islamic World: KazanSummit”.
